Mastering the Multi-Stage Bilona Procedure

    Reaching the pinnacle of A2 Gir cow ghee quality demands an unbroken adherence to the traditional Bilona protocol. Rather than skimming cream directly from raw milk via centrifugal separators, authentic production follows a meticulous multi-phase sequence:

Natural Curdling: Farm-fresh A2 milk is gently warmed and inoculated with wild culture overnight, transforming into rich, probiotic-dense curd (dahi) at room temperature.

Bidirectional Churning: At dawn, artisans use a wooden rotary tool called a mathani to churn the curd back and forth slowly, separating pure white butter (makkhan) from nutrient-rich buttermilk without generating damaging friction heat.

Traditional Wood-Fire Simmering: The collected butter is transferred to heavy vessels and simmered slowly over a controlled wood flame, allowing moisture to evaporate gently while caramelizing milk solids into aromatic sediment.
